Proposal

Removal of sycamore tree. Tree is 3.3 metres away from the property and poses a risk of subsidence to the rear of the property. Sycamores have expansive, aggressive, and relatively shallow root networks and the soil is predominantly clay on the property. Large overhang of branches over the roof of the rear of the property pose a risk to damage if one breaks and falls. Also causing moss to form on the roof tiles, which has to be removed annually. Planting several upright hawthorns Crataegus monogyna Stricta along the boundary of the property. Maintenance of cherry tree to the front of the property, pruning and raising the crown slightly to preserve and maintain the tree. Both trees are marked on the property map attached to this application along with photographs.

About tree works applications

Applications for works to trees cover protected trees: consent under a tree preservation order, or six weeks notice for trees in a conservation area. More in our guide to planning application types.
